Interface JTypeFactory
- All Known Implementing Classes:
JSimpleTypeFactory
public interface JTypeFactory
-
Method Summary
Modifier and TypeMethodDescriptionnewMetaVarType(int identity, String name) newMetaVarType(String name) newNoneType(String name) newPrimitiveType(JClassNamespace namespace, JClassNamespace box, JDescriptor.Primitive descriptor)
-
Method Details
-
newArrayType
JArrayType newArrayType() -
newClassReference
JClassReference newClassReference() -
newIntersectionType
JIntersectionType newIntersectionType() -
newMetaVarType
-
newMetaVarType
-
newMethodReference
JMethodReference newMethodReference() -
newNoneType
-
newParameterizedClassType
JParameterizedClassType newParameterizedClassType() -
newParameterizedMethodType
JParameterizedMethodType newParameterizedMethodType() -
newPrimitiveType
JPrimitiveType newPrimitiveType(JClassNamespace namespace, JClassNamespace box, JDescriptor.Primitive descriptor) -
newVarType
JVarType newVarType() -
newLowerWildType
JWildType.Lower newLowerWildType() -
newUpperWildType
JWildType.Upper newUpperWildType() -
newFieldReference
JFieldReference newFieldReference()
-